Course Overview
The Bachelor of Engineering (Honours) at the University of Technology Sydney (UTS) is a comprehensive undergraduate program designed to equip students with the technical skills, problem-solving abilities, and innovative thinking required to excel in various engineering disciplines. The course emphasizes practical, hands-on experience through industry projects, internships, and state-of-the-art facilities, ensuring graduates are job-ready. Unique features include flexible specializations in areas such as civil, mechanical, electrical, and biomedical engineering, as well as a strong focus on sustainability and emerging technologies.
Career Prospects
Graduates of this program are well-prepared for diverse roles in engineering and related fields. The course's strong industry connections and practical focus contribute to high employability, with many students securing positions in leading firms or pursuing further studies. Common sectors include construction, manufacturing, energy, telecommunications, and technology.

Unique Facilities and Partnerships
UTS offers access to cutting-edge facilities such as advanced engineering labs, simulation centers, and maker spaces. The university maintains strong partnerships with industry leaders, providing students with opportunities for real-world projects and internships. Collaborative initiatives with government and private sectors further enhance the learning experience.
